PRESENTATION SYNOPSIS: Today's Cyber Threats With today’s changing environment, cyber threats are continuing to pose risks to all organizations. From the viewpoint of intelligence agencies, the threat landscape is about as volatile as they’ve seen it. Our speaker this month is Special Agent Charles McGuinness, from the Federal Bureau of Investigations (FBI) Tampa Division. Charles will be updating us on the current threat landscape and will discuss mitigation strategies. There will also be a time for taking your questions on issues that may be currently emerging for different private sectors. ABOUT THE PRESENTER: Special Agent Charles McGuinness is the Private Sector Coordinator for the Tampa Division on the Gulf Coast from Fort Myers up to Hernando County north of Tampa Bay. SA McGuinness is the Tampa Division liaison for the InfraGard program in Tampa, assigned to provide coordination and assistance to private sector and critical infrastructure entities in the Gulf Coast region. SA McGuinness works to disseminate and translate intelligence and threat management awareness in order to assist corporate partners and critical infrastructure. Serving in the FBI for over 19 years, SA McGuinness has conducted investigations leading to prosecution and served as a supervisor for various criminal and national security programs at FBI Headquarters and in Central Florida since 2017. SA McGuinness has served the FBI in Oklahoma City, Corpus Christi, Texas, FBIHQ in Washington DC, and the Tampa Division.
